Hang Loose Pro, Fernando de Noronha - Finals recap

The 2009 Hang Loose Pro has wrapped up on Sunday on the beautiful island of Fernando de Noronha, crowning Brazilian charger and World Tour giant killer, Bruno Santos as the winner.  The 5 star event concluded in head high to overhead crystal clear barrels, making for an exciting end to the competition.

Bruno’s path to victory began in Round 1, where he finished second in his all Brazilian heat to Bernardo Miranda, ousting Rafael Venuto and Raimar Sousa.  He proceeded to win his Round 2 heat, narrowly topping Renato Galvao, and showing the exit to Dunga Neto and Jorge Spanner.  Bruno won again in Round 3, topping Ian Gouveia, and ousting Hizunome Bettero, and then put down Renato Galvao permanently in Round 4.  He handily defeated Ian Gouveia in the Quarterfinals before comboing Marcelo Trekinho in the Semifinals, and comboing last year’s champion, Raoni Monteiro in the Finals.  Though there were only a handful of international surfers in the event, Bruno managed to surf from Round 1 to the Finals without encountering a single one.

The 2000 point haul puts Bruno Santos at the head of the pack, unseating prior WQS leader and current World Tour surfer, Nathaniel Curran (USA), who had taken home 1500 points with his win at the Sebastian Inlet Pro back in January.
